Kanichukulangara Devi temple fireworks on Shivratri night (23 Feb 09) attracts ten thousands of pilgrims. The temple is located 7 km from Cherthala in...
Added on Feb 27, 2009
Views: 3063 | Comments: 0 | Likes: 0
Videos: 107
There is no response video found.